Transaction edb72d70e32d47c44dabfd100c77d31660ed7785a2f2960b213ab2ee41118579

1 Input
2 Outputs
  • edb72d70e32d47c44dabfd100c77d31660ed7785a2f2960b213ab2ee41118579:0
  • value  1533913
    address  34xay69ZVCvpUVTNmyVyNap3K2MxwryNaD
  • edb72d70e32d47c44dabfd100c77d31660ed7785a2f2960b213ab2ee41118579:1
  • value  20881608
    address  1BVtknyoZTAmYvjeVK3bdhHCVj1J5hx7tQ